@charset "UTF-8";
/***********For Products CSS************/

#content_left{
background:url(../images/bg_contents_pink.gif) no-repeat left top;
}
#content_left .contents_box .products{
width: 350px;
border-right:#ccc 1px solid;
border-top:#ccc 1px solid;
color:#333;
font-size:11px;
}

#content_left .contents_box .w754{
width:100%;
}
#content_left .contents_box .w450{
width: 450px;
}


#content_left .contents_box .center{
text-align:center;
}
#content_left .contents_box .products th,
#content_left .contents_box .products td{
border-left:#ccc 1px solid;
border-bottom:#ccc 1px solid;
padding:3px;
}
#content_left .contents_box .products th{
background:#eee;
}

#content_left .contents_box .products td.size{
background:#ddd;
}

#content_left .dot-y{
color:#ff0;
}
#content_left .dot-b{
color:#0066FF;
}
#content_left .dot-g{
color:#00CC00;
}


#content_left .contents_box table.noborder,
#content_left .contents_box table.noborder td,
#content_left .contents_box table.noborder th{
border:none;
padding:0;
}

.indent{
padding-left:1em;
text-indent:-1em;
}

/***書籍***/
#content_left .books{
width:500px;
padding:15px 67px;
}